Chime Financial (NasdaqGS:CHYM) 2025 Conference Transcript
2025-12-03 20:57
Summary of Chime Financial Conference Call Company Overview - Chime Financial is positioned as a leader in the digital banking sector, targeting nearly 200 million U.S. adults earning up to $100K, a demographic often overlooked by traditional banks [5][6] - 97% of Chime members report improved financial progress, and the company has been recognized as the number one bank brand in America by J.D. Power [5][6] Key Points and Arguments Digital Banking Shift - There is a significant shift towards digital banking in America, with Chime at the forefront [5] - The company focuses on solving critical financial needs and has innovated its cost structure to provide better value to consumers [6] Primary Account Relationships - Chime has achieved high success in converting members to primary account status, driven by product innovation [8] - The average active member conducts 55 transactions per month, indicating strong engagement [10] - Tenured cohorts use an average of four products monthly, with revenue per active member (RPAM) increasing from $250 to $350 [11] Targeting Higher-Income Segments - The fastest-growing segment for Chime includes individuals earning over $75K, with a focus on high-yield savings and rewards products [12][14] - Chime offers a 3.5% interest rate on high-yield savings accounts, significantly above the national average [14] Ungating Strategy - Chime has implemented an ungating strategy to allow non-direct depositors access to certain products, resulting in increased member growth and improved unit economics [16][18] - The company added 1.6 million new active members in the past year, up from 1.2 million the previous year [18] Competitive Advantages - Chime's cost structure is significantly lower than traditional banks, with a transaction margin of approximately 70% [22] - The transition to Chime Core, an in-house payment processor, has reduced processing costs by over 50% [23] Chime Card - The Chime Card, a secured credit card, offers 1.5% cash back and is designed to enhance customer engagement and acquisition [27][28] - New cohorts using the Chime Card are spending approximately 80% of their transactions through it [29] Liquidity Products - Chime's liquidity products, such as MyPay and Instant Loans, account for about 20% of revenue and are designed to provide short-term credit with low risk [36] - The company benefits from a unique repayment position, as it is the first to be repaid when direct deposits come in [35] Economic Resilience - Chime has observed resilience in consumer spending, particularly in non-discretionary categories, despite economic challenges [38][40] - The model is designed to perform well in both good and tough economic times, with a focus on low-cost services [41] Chime Enterprise - Chime Enterprise aims to provide financial wellness solutions to employers, leveraging partnerships with platforms like Workday and UKG [43][44] - Early adoption rates among employees have exceeded expectations, indicating strong market interest [44] Growth Framework - Key growth levers include increasing active members and revenue per member, with a focus on cross-selling additional products [47][48] - The company expects to see improvements in profit margins due to operational efficiencies and AI integration in customer support [50][51] Additional Important Insights - Chime's customer support has improved significantly due to AI initiatives, leading to higher customer satisfaction scores [51] - The company anticipates continued growth in adjusted EBITDA margins, projecting an 11-point improvement in Q4 [52]

Chime Financial Inc-A(CHYM) - 2025 Q3 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-11-05 23:02
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company achieved a 29% year-over-year revenue growth in Q3, with an adjusted EBITDA margin rising to 5%, up 9 percentage points year-over-year [20][26] - Revenue run rate reached $2 billion, with expectations for Q4 revenue between $572 million and $582 million, indicating a year-over-year growth of 20% to 23% [6][27] - Adjusted EBITDA for the full year is projected to be between $113 million and $118 million, exceeding prior guidance [29]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- Active members increased by 21% year-over-year to 9.1 million, with a sequential increase of approximately 400,000 from Q2 [8][20] - The MyPay product has reached a $350 million annual run rate with a transaction margin exceeding 45% [11][25] - Average revenue per active member (RPAM) grew 6% year-over-year to $245, with seasoned cohorts achieving over $350 RPAM [23][24]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- Chime's unaided awareness in the online banking category reached 41%, up 12 points since 2023, indicating strong brand recognition [12] - The fastest-growing consumer segment includes members earning $75,000 or more annually, highlighting a shift in demographics [10][12]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on enhancing its product offerings, including the new Chime Card, which provides 1.5% cash back and aims to improve customer engagement [10][15] - ChimeCore migration has been completed ahead of schedule, expected to increase gross margins to close to 90% in Q4, enabling further product innovation [14][25] - Future product roadmap includes premium membership tiers, joint accounts, custodial accounts, and investment products, aimed at expanding service offerings [15][67]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the resilience of their member base despite macroeconomic risks, noting strong financial health among members [8][9] - The company anticipates continued strong growth in 2026, with expectations for improved adjusted EBITDA margins and slower operating expense growth [29][30] Other Important Information - A $200 million share repurchase authorization was announced, reflecting a robust cash position and strong outlook on free cash flow generation [18] - The company is optimistic about the early traction of its Chime Enterprise business unit, which aims to provide solutions to employees of enterprise partners [17][62] Q&A Session Summary Question: Member growth and competitive landscape - Management noted strong momentum in member growth, with a 21% increase in active members and a competitive edge in attracting direct depositors [32][34] Question: Payment volume per user and consumer health - Management clarified that while payment volume per user appeared down, overall transaction volumes remained consistent, with a shift towards outbound instant transfers impacting reported figures [41][44] Question: Margin improvement and MyPay loss rates - Management highlighted significant progress in MyPay loss rates, with expectations for continued margin expansion as the product matures [46][48] Question: MyPay and instant loans - Management discussed the trajectory of MyPay, emphasizing ongoing improvements in underwriting and loss rates, while also expressing excitement about the instant loan product's high customer satisfaction [50][56] Question: Chime Enterprise and partnerships - Management provided insights into the early success of the Chime Enterprise initiative, noting strong adoption rates among employees of partner companies [58][62] Question: Chime Card rollout and rewards costs - Management confirmed high attach rates for new cohorts using the Chime Card, with rewards costs accounted for as contra-revenue [80][81]
